Tom Brown’s Restaurant coming to Hays Farm Development

Big news South Huntsville! The Market at Hays Farm developers, Branch Properties, announced today Tom Brown’s Restaurant will be opening their second location at the Market at Hays Farm! The steak and seafood restaurant will occupy a 6,000-square-foot space at the Publix- and Staples-anchored development. Owned and operated by Tom Brown and friend Paul Daley, both seasoned restaurateurs, the eatery focuses on providing the freshest ingredients in a casual, yet elevated, atmosphere.

In an effort to differentiate The Market at Hays Farm location from the flagship restaurant at The Shoppes of Madison in Madison, Ala., Brown and his wife Ashley are designing the new restaurant with modern, cool colors, complemented by bold pieces of art and gold hardware accents. “Despite a challenging year, my team and I are looking forward to continuing our passion and growing our restaurant brand as one of the top choices for premium casual dining in the Huntsville area,” said Brown. “The Market at Hays Farm will be an ideal location as we expand into the community, and we are looking forward to opening our doors next fall.”
